com.groupbyinc.flux.action.admin.indices.alias.Alias.class Maven / Gradle / Ivy
???? 4i 4com/groupbyinc/flux/action/admin/indices/alias/Alias java/lang/Object /com/groupbyinc/flux/common/io/stream/Streamable 6com/groupbyinc/flux/common/xcontent/ToXContentFragment
Alias.java 8com/groupbyinc/flux/common/xcontent/XContentParser$Token
2com/groupbyinc/flux/common/xcontent/XContentParser Token 5com/groupbyinc/flux/common/xcontent/ToXContent$Params .com/groupbyinc/flux/common/xcontent/ToXContent Params FILTER 'Lcom/groupbyinc/flux/common/ParseField; ROUTING
INDEX_ROUTING SEARCH_ROUTING IS_WRITE_INDEX name Ljava/lang/String; filter %Lcom/groupbyinc/flux/common/Nullable; indexRouting
searchRouting
writeIndex Ljava/lang/Boolean; ()V " #
$ this 6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; (Ljava/lang/String;)V ) ()Ljava/lang/String; , J(Ljava/lang/String;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; G(Ljava/util/Map;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; java/io/IOException 0
java/util/Map 2 isEmpty ()Z 4 5 3 6 0com/groupbyinc/flux/common/xcontent/XContentType 8 JSON 2Lcom/groupbyinc/flux/common/xcontent/XContentType; : ; 9 < 3com/groupbyinc/flux/common/xcontent/XContentFactory > contentBuilder i(Lcom/groupbyinc/flux/common/xcontent/XContentType;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; @ A
? B 3com/groupbyinc/flux/common/xcontent/XContentBuilder D map F(Ljava/util/Map;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; F G
E H "com/groupbyinc/flux/common/Strings J toString I(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;)Ljava/lang/String; L M
K N 4com/groupbyinc/flux/ElasticsearchGenerationException P java/lang/StringBuilder R
S $ Failed to generate [ U append -(Ljava/lang/String;)Ljava/lang/StringBuilder; W X
S Y -(Ljava/lang/Object;)Ljava/lang/StringBuilder; W [
S \ ] ^ L +
S ` *(Ljava/lang/String;Ljava/lang/Throwable;)V " b
Q c builder 5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; e Ljava/io/IOException; 5Ljava/util/Map; Ljava/util/Map; f(Lcom/groupbyinc/flux/index/query/QueryBuilder;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; jsonBuilder 7()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; l m
? n EMPTY_PARAMS 7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params; p q r ,com/groupbyinc/flux/index/query/QueryBuilder t
toXContent ?(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der; v w u x close z #
E { &Failed to build json for alias request }
filterBuilder .Lcom/groupbyinc/flux/index/query/QueryBuilder; routing ? ? ()Ljava/lang/Boolean; ! ? K(Ljava/lang/Boolean;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; read j(Lcom/groupbyinc/flux/common/io/stream/StreamInput;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ias;
$ readFrom 5(Lcom/groupbyinc/flux/common/io/stream/StreamInput;)V ? ?
? in 2Lcom/groupbyinc/flux/common/io/stream/StreamInput; alias 0com/groupbyinc/flux/common/io/stream/StreamInput ?
readString ? +
? ? readOptionalString ? +
? ?
getVersion ()Lcom/groupbyinc/flux/Version; ? ?
? ? com/groupbyinc/flux/Version ? V_6_4_0 Lcom/groupbyinc/flux/Version; ? ? ? ? onOrAfter (Lcom/groupbyinc/flux/Version;)Z ? ?
? ? readOptionalBoolean ? ?
? ? writeTo 6(Lcom/groupbyinc/flux/common/io/stream/StreamOutput;)V 1com/groupbyinc/flux/common/io/stream/StreamOutput ? writeString ? (
? ? writeOptionalString ? (
? ?
? ? writeOptionalBoolean (Ljava/lang/Boolean;)V ? ?
? ? out 3Lcom/groupbyinc/flux/common/io/stream/StreamOutput; fromXContent l(Lcom/groupbyinc/flux/common/xcontent/XContentParser;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; currentName ? +
? " (
? nextToken <()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token; ? ?
? "java/lang/IllegalArgumentException ? No alias is specified ?
? ? java/lang/String ?
END_OBJECT :Lcom/groupbyinc/flux/common/xcontent/XContentParser$Token; ? ? ?
FIELD_NAME ? ? ? START_OBJECT ? ? ? ? getDeprecationHandler :()Lcom/groupbyinc/flux/common/xcontent/DeprecationHandler; ? ?
? %com/groupbyinc/flux/common/ParseField ? match M(Ljava/lang/String;Lcom/groupbyinc/flux/common/xcontent/DeprecationHandler;)Z ? ?
? ?
mapOrdered ()Ljava/util/Map; ? ?
? /
? VALUE_STRING ? ? ? ? text ? +
? ? .
? ? .
? ? .
?
VALUE_BOOLEAN ? ? ? booleanValue 5
java/lang/Boolean valueOf (Z)Ljava/lang/Boolean;
?
parser 4Lcom/groupbyinc/flux/common/xcontent/XContentParser; currentFieldName token java/lang/Throwable startObject I(Ljava/lang/String;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;
E +com/groupbyinc/flux/common/bytes/BytesArray
? streamInput 4()Lcom/groupbyinc/flux/common/io/stream/StreamInput;
getPreferredName +
? rawField ?(Ljava/lang/String;Ljava/io/InputStream;Lcom/groupbyinc/flux/common/xcontent/XContentType;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;"#
E$ java/io/InputStream&
' {
addSuppressed (Ljava/lang/Throwable;)V)*
+ equals (Ljava/lang/Object;)Z-.
?/ field [(Ljava/lang/String;Ljava/lang/String;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;12
E3 \(Ljava/lang/String;Ljava/lang/Boolean;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;15
E6 endObject8 m
E9 stream Ljava/io/InputStream; params D(Lcom/groupbyinc/flux/common/xcontent/ToXContent;)Ljava/lang/String; L>
K? getClass ()Ljava/lang/Class;AB
C o Ljava/lang/Object; hashCode ()IGH
?I ((Ljava/lang/String;[Ljava/lang/String;)V "M
?N ?
index_routingQ
index-routingT search_routingV search-routingY is_write_index[ RuntimeVisibleAnnotations Code LocalVariableTable LineNumberTable LocalVariableTypeTable
StackMapTable Signature m(Ljava/util/Map;)Lcom/groupbyinc/flux/action/admin/indices/alias/Alias; "RuntimeVisibleParameterAnnotations
Exceptions
SourceFile InnerClasses !
] ] ] ! ] " # ^ 3 *? %? _ &